Lunch here is always fantastic. Try the burger! Both the burger and chips are really fantastic, and this goes for a lot of the lunch offerings. 5 stars if it were only lunch. Unfortunately, the breakfast is a bit of a letdown. The fry was average (awful sausages), and the avocado and poached egg on toast was a bit vague and unsure of itself. Generally, the staff are lovely and the location is excellent.

I came here for breakfast with my husband and we had a lovely time. My bacon maple pancakes had a generous amount of maple syrup, which was a pleasant surprise, I was very happy about not having to ask for more syrup (not a whole lot of maple trees in Ireland, lol). The restaurant was clean, the service was good, and the food was delicious. I got one of their banoffee tarts to go and it was amazing! So good, I highly recommend trying it. My only complaint would be that parking is pretty scarce. It was difficult to find a parking space nearby.

We had a lovely lunch here. My daughter had the croque Madame which was delicious. It was huge and I had to help out. The quality of the ham inside was outstanding. I had the sirloin on sourdough which I enjoyed. However the taste of the meat was somewhat obscured by the very peppery sauce which had been poured all.over it. All in all a very enjoyable occasion.
